Introduction


Throughout this project I will create a sports inspired fashion garment. To gather inspiration I will collate a range of primary research. This will be gathered from several visits to sports related shops and venues. As well as using primary research, I will also use secondary research to find designer references and extra information about different types of sports, and the history behind them. When making my final garment I will take inspiration from my chosen sport. To help develop design ideas I will use methods such as cutting old sports clothing and remodelling them on the stand, also using sports equipment to create lines and patterns which will develop into design ideas. When it comes to constructing my final garment I will explore effective zip fastenings, creative seaming, piping and drawstring/panelling. This will make my garment detailed and interesting as well as textured. Throughout this project I will look at designers such as Thom Browne, Jeremy Scott and Fred Perry. I will also look at special sports wear collections designed by fashion designers such as Marc Jacob’s collection for Vans and Alexander Mcqueens collection for Puma. These designer references will help inspire my garment to be current and suitable for the ready to wear brief. After researching a wide range of sports I will choose a specific sport to research in more detail, I will then use this to inspire my final garment. I will look at everything from the equipment used to the venues it’s played in and hopefully create a successful garment inspired by sports.
